Study Notes

Grammar and Vocabulary

  • Grammar:
    • Focuses on grammatical accuracy, sentence formation, and language functions (e.g., making suggestions, expressing opinions)
    • Tests knowledge of:
      • Tenses (e.g., present perfect, past perfect, future perfect)
      • Clause structures (e.g., relative clauses, subordinate clauses)
      • Modal verbs (e.g., can, could, may, might)
      • Passive voice
      • Conditional sentences
  • Vocabulary:
    • Assesses ability to use vocabulary in context
    • Tests knowledge of:
      • Word formation (e.g., prefixes, suffixes)
      • Word choice (e.g., synonyms, antonyms)
      • Idiomatic expressions and phrasal verbs
      • Collocations and fixed expressions

Reading Comprehension

  • Format:
    • 3-4 reading passages (around 800-900 words in total)
    • Multiple-choice questions, gapped text, and multiple-matching tasks
  • Skills tested:
    • Ability to understand main ideas, supporting details, and implied meaning
    • Ability to identify the writer's tone, purpose, and attitude
    • Ability to recognize the relationships between sentences and paragraphs
    • Ability to make inferences and deductions from the text
